Default Official 2005 Leavers Week Dates Released

I got a call from the Premier's Department about dates for Leavers Week in 2005. They have specified that all Leaver's Week destinations will be welcoming leavers between these dates [only] and any entertainment / support services will only be running during this time.

The official Leaver's Week dates for 2005 are: Thursday 24th of Nov. to Wednesday 30th of Nov. Our recommendation is to book your Leaver's Week accommodation within these dates.

Take into account also... these are just dates from the gov. Schoolies / Leaver's Week is a tradition amongst young people, not an event put on by the gov, that people attend. If the graduate class of 2005 decided leavers runs from 1st dec to 8th of dec... that's when it's on. Once we find out from them what they plan to offer during the official dates, you will know what you will be missing out on if your booking falls outside the 'official' dates. The main advantage I would be aiming for is to go when most other people are going and to any entertainment that's on and when safety and support services are in place.
